Red Flags

The following concerns were identified during AI analysis of Institute For Nursing Inc's IRS 990 filings:

  • Consistent 0% reported compensation for all officers, directors, trustees, and key employees across all years, which is highly unusual and may indicate incomplete reporting or an all-volunteer leadership structure not explicitly stated.
  • Total liabilities consistently exceed total assets, with liabilities at $1,206,122 and assets at $980,499 in 2024, indicating potential long-term financial instability.
  • Assets have shown a declining trend from $1,162,848 in 2017 to $980,499 in 2024, while liabilities have generally increased over the same period.

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Institute For Nursing Inc showing financial trends over 14 years of public records:

Over 14 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2024), Institute For Nursing Inc's revenue has declined by 9.8%, moving from $878K to $792K. Total assets increased by 5.8% over the same period, from $927K to $980K. Total functional expenses rose by 7%, from $786K to $841K. In its most recent filing year (2024), Institute For Nursing Inc reported a deficit of $49K, with expenses exceeding revenue. The organization holds $1.2M in liabilities against $980K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 123.0%), resulting in net assets of $-225,623.

Data Sources and Methodology

This transparency report for Institute For Nursing Inc is generated by NonprofitSpending's AI analysis engine. The data is sourced from publicly available IRS 990 filings accessed through the ProPublica Nonprofit Explorer API and IRS electronic filing records. The Mission Score, spending breakdown, and other analytical insights are produced by artificial intelligence and should be used as one of multiple factors when evaluating a nonprofit organization.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
